HOPKINTON, Mass. -- EMC Corporation (NYSE: EMC - News), the world leader in information infrastructure solutions, today announced one of the largest American-owned spirits and wine companies is leveraging EMC Documentum® software to help manage a wide array of unstructured and interactive content types within three of the company's key marketing applications.

Brown-Forman Corporation is recognized as one of the top-10 largest spirits companies, employing 4,750 people worldwide. It sells 37 brands internationally including Jack Daniel's, Southern Comfort and Finlandia Vodka. The company implemented the Documentum enterprise content management (ECM) platform to help it manage interactive content and brand assets for marketing and advertising programs, such as high-resolution artwork, photography, presentations and branded digital press room web sites.

Brown-Forman places a premium on managing its brand assets and interactive content, deeming these to be critical to engaging customers with information that educates, involves and entertains. Taking advantage of the EMC Documentum platform and EMC Captiva® software for document capture, Brown-Forman is able to consolidate information silos and more efficiently manage content across the enterprise -- from invoices and paper documents to photographs and digital videos.

"Because we are faced with an ever-increasing amount of business content to manage, the task of finding an enterprise content management solution became a top priority for us," said Brown-Forman Lead Systems Engineer Rob Price. "In EMC Documentum, we found a solution that enabled us to reduce cycle time for invoice processing, seamlessly deliver brand assets and quickly publish on the Web. Taking this one step further, the platform has also allowed us to reduce mailing costs and advertising agency fees, increased our visibility and facilitated outsourcing of non-strategic tasks. We look forward to unlocking even more of the power of EMC Documentum in the months and years to come."
